Hiperco 50 is a soft magnetic alloy which has been used primarily as magnetic core material in electrical core material in electrical equipment requiring high permeability values at very high magnetic flux densities.
The magnetic characteristics of this alloy permit weight reduction, reduction of copper turns, and insulation in the end product when compared to other magnetic alloys having lower permeabilities in the same magnetic field range.
Heat Treatment
When selecting a heat treating temperature for the application, two factors should be considered:
1. For best magnetic characteristics, select the highest suggested temperature.
2. If the application requires specific mechanical properties higher than that produced when employing the highest temperature, select the temperature that will provide desired mechanical properties.
As temperature decreases, magnetic properties become less magnetic. Heat treating temperature for best magnetic properties should be 1625°F +/- 25°F (885°C +/- 15°C).Do not exceed 1652°F(900°C).
The heat treating atmosphere used must be nonoxiding and noncarburizing. Atmospheres such as dry hydrogen or high vacuum are suggested. Time at temperature should be two to four hours. Cool at a rate of nominally 180 to 360°F (100 to 200°C) per hour to a temperature of least 700°F(370°C), then cool naturally to room temperature.
